The atkListAttribute is used for list several options in a select. In database it can be a varchar.

Params

The constructor of the atkBoolAttribute has the following params:

atkListAttribute (mixed $name, mixed $optionArray, [mixed $valueArray = ""], [mixed $flags = 0])
  • name String

Name of the attribute (the same as the fieldname used in the database)

  • optionArray Array

Array with options to be show. It valueArray is not passed, or null, it will be save at database too.

  • valueArray (optional) Array

Array with values to be save to database.

  • flags (optional) Integer

Flags for the attribute. For more information about flags, please checkout the flags section.


Examples

(in a node constructor):

 $this->add(new atkListAttribute("fruit", array("orange", "lemon", "grape"));

Adds a field fruit to the node. In the admin this will be displayed as select with "orange", "lemon", "grape".

$this->add(new atkListAttribute("fruit", array("orange", "lemon", "grape"), array(1,2,3), AF_LIST_OBLIGATORY_NULL_ITEM);

The same, but instead of save fruit names to database, it will save 1, 2 or 3. Also, there will be a default option that will save null to database.
